    Breast Centers

    The Breast Centers of Covenant Health offer patients access to the latest technological advances in prevention, early detection, diagnosis, and treatment of breast cancer.    With a multi-disciplinary approach to care, teams of professionals work closely to involve patients so they are educated, supported and comforted through their care. 

     

    Comprehensive Cancer Care
    All of the Breast Centers offer state-of-the-art digital mammography systems.  Screening mammograms are essential to breast health.  The sooner a problem is identified, the better a woman’s chance for survival.   Covenant Health has additional technologies for the early detection of breast cancer, including breast ultrasound and MRI, and is committed to providing physicians with the tools they need to provide the best care for their patients. 

     

    If cancer is found, advance and effective treatment is available.  Teams of dedicated specialists, including a medical oncologist, radiation oncologist, surgical oncologist and radiologist, work together to develop comprehensive care plans to provide the best treatment possible.

    October is National Breast Cancer Awareness Month
    More and more women are getting mammograms to detect breast cancer in its earliest stages.  As a result, breast cancer deaths are on the decline.  If you're age 40 or older, join the millions of women who have their mammograms on a regular basis.

    Breast Cancer
    Screening Guidelines

    Breast self exam--monthly
    Clinical breast exam-- 
     Every 3 years after age 20
     Annually after age 40
    Mammography--
     Every year after age 40
